Standard Grooming Policies

Black Applicant In California Says He Was Denied A Job Due To His Hair.

Jeffrey Thornton, Black audio and visual expert who applied for a position as a technical supervisor in San Diego, has sued Encore Group, LLC, for allegedly denying him an opportunity because of his hair. According to CNN. Thornton said the company expected him to cut his locks. "In order to take the job, Mr. Thornton would have to materially alter his hairstyle, and thus his appearance, cultural identity, and racial heritage," the complaint stated. #hiringevents #interview #application #firstjob

If you’re a new college graduate, or you’re looking to try a totally different career, you may be feeling a mixture of excitement and fear. Getting your feet wet in a brand new field is a big step. Unfortunately, it can be difficult to get your foot — or even a toe — in the door. A common dilemma faced by many recent graduates or career changers is the fact that it’s hard to get a job without experience. But how do you get the skills if no one will hire you? Since many employers are reluctant to train new hires on the job, it can be an uphill battle.

If you find yourself in this predicament, don’t give up. There are some careers that pay handsomely even if you don’t have years of related work experience and advanced education under your belt. Rather, you can gain expertise on the job through an apprenticeship and other on-the-job training programs. Sound too good to be true? It’s not.
